Output 070017514f2f75c31bf3a3d9879f309f8942e7d808e071fc45e9bb5de35be38f:2

value
3766195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cd044bda2067f1450929130f5dca9872cf6a81b OP_EQUAL
address
3FzAqDhBi3sLWd8qfk6zVc5BvyN2hVR25X
transaction
070017514f2f75c31bf3a3d9879f309f8942e7d808e071fc45e9bb5de35be38f
spent
true